HI all Our 7.0 chapter template has 4 character styles well defined, namely Emphasis, Strong Emphasis, Keytroke and Code. Their use cases is described in the template.
After some exercise translating a Guide to pt-BR, I think we need a fifth style to define some objects in the software UI. Many dialog boxes elements have names that often confuses the reading when it is not highlighted and things get worse in other languages. "Click OK in the Insert field dialog" -> "Insert field" "In the Security area, choose..." -> "Security". Are these the cases for a specific character style that better highlight the several objects in the user interface, not covered by the other 4 characters styles? Just asking. The cases above occurs several hundred times.
